Baby can climb on tables and sofas. Also may stand erect with slight support.
-
Explores different features of objects and begins to form concepts. The baby notices actions of other children and adults.
-
Walks fast, runs swiftly and improves motion first using whole body then using just arm movements.
-
Very inquisitive about everything. Scribbles more freely but can also draw and imitate strokes of a drawing.
-
Holds containers in one hand, puts small objects in the other hand then dumps objects out. Squats easily in play.
-
Looks at books for longer periods of time, studying pictures. Constantly ask "what's that?"
-
Can sit itself in small chairs with ease. Likes to walk on low walls and perform other stunts.
-
Becomes interested in the percise placement of objects. Enjoys form boards and simple puzzles. Curious about objects in the enivroment, feels, squeezes and pushes objects.
-
Remembers sequence of stories and may be able to retell them. Understands cause and effects in terms of own behavior.
-
Climbs on jungle gym with fair amount of ease. Plays on swings, ladders and other playground equipment.
-
Walks on tiptoes. Begins to verbalize toilet needs.
-
Becomes more skilled in putting puzzles together. Connects names and uses many objects.
